About Watalgan

Watalgan is a rural locality in the Bundaberg Region of Queensland, located about 12 kilometres east of Rosedale and 46 kilometres north-west of Bundaberg. Named after the Watalgan Range, believed to be of Aboriginal origin, the locality features sugarcane and mixed-farming country. The North Coast railway line passes through, and the area lies just 7 kilometres from the coast.
